A 7 speed automatic gearbox transmits the power to the driven wheels. Quoted weight at the kerb is 1288 kg. It is claimed to attain a maxiumum speed of 212 km/h (132 mph), officially quoted fuel consumption is 6.1/4.4/5.0 l/100km urban/extra-urban/combined, and carbon dioxide emissions are 116.0 g/km. The engine powers the wheels via a 7 speed automatic transmission. The Volkswagen Golf Variant 1.4 TSI DSG weighs a claimed 1351 kg at the kerb. Maximum speed claimed is 201 km/h or 125 mph, official fuel consumption figures are 7.7/5.1/6.0 l/100km urban/extra-urban/combined, and carbon dioxide emissions are 139.0 g/km. Full specs

The 1.4 TSI 122ps is a good engine, fairly torquey and very low turbo lag as it uses a smallish turbo and a special water cooled intercooler built into the intake manifold (low air volume so gets boost pressure up quickly)
